The spa in Szentes was classified as a health resort
The Budapest government office with national competence has classified the Szentes spa and its surroundings as a health resort – the turizmus.com portal reported.
According to the article, the Szentes spa was built in 1962 based on the plans of Károly Dávid. There are six swimming pools with different temperatures on its territory.
In the institution, among many other diseases, diseases such as metabolic disorders, diseases of the skeletal system, digestive system and biliary disorders, locomotor problems, rheumatism, excess weight, physical and mental exhaustion or even the group of symptoms during the period of change can be treated.
The health resort certification can be initiated by the representative bodies of the settlements where some natural healing factor is found – they wrote.
Only forty places in the Hungary can bear the title.
